Asbestos, a silicate fibrous mineral is a mineral that occurs naturally.

Asbestos is a naturally occurring silicate mineral with a fibrous structure, was utilized as a building material in the past. It was used for its fire-resistant, corrosive resistant and insulation properties. However, it was later banned due to its association with serious health problems. These include mesothelioma and asbestosis and pleural disease. After exposure, symptoms can appear between 15 and 30 year later.

There are five different kinds of asbestos the most common being chrysotile (serpentine) and the amphibole group of minerals (crocidolite, amosite, anthophyllite, tremolite and byssolite). They vary in their size and shape. Amphibole is distinct from chrysotile, which has long thin fibers. While there are some differences, all of these types can be found in a single sample, and could even be mixed on the microscopic level.

All forms of asbestos are toxic and should be avoided. However, some products might contain asbestos, but they are not recognized because they don't conform to the commercial definition of asbestos. This includes vermiculite, talc, and certain rock samples. Although they do not pose the same health risks as asbestos, they may still cause health issues when the material is handled or disturbed.

Workers are exposed when they handle or process these materials. Asbestos exposure is also a possibility during ship repairs, construction work, and the manufacture of friction materials like brake linings and clutches. Contaminated soil can also contain asbestos.

Asbestos-contaminated sites pose a risk to people, including the general public and emergency responders. It is important to follow strict safety guidelines when handling asbestos-contaminated soil. Workers should be protected with respirators and protective clothing and all wet rags, pPE and cleaning materials must be bagged and sealed prior to disposal. It is also recommended that they wash their hands immediately after taking off the protective clothing since dust can remain on the skin and clothes.

Many older homes still have asbestos-containing materials. These can be found in insulation, roofing and siding shingles, paper products, felts, as well as drywall. The materials may release tiny asbestos fibers in the air when they are disturbed. These fibers can be inhaled and can lead to serious health issues, such as mesothelioma, lung cancer, and pleural diseases.

Compensation may be available for a person who suffered from an asbestos-related illness. This is called an asbestos death claim. It is a type of wrongful death lawsuit that could help family members receive financial compensation for their loss. This compensation may be used to pay for funeral expenses, medical bills for the final days, and other damages.

A person who was related to the deceased, or was a representative of their estate is able to file a claim on behalf of asbestos-related death. It is vital to submit your claim within the stipulated time frame. It is also recommended to work with an attorney who is experienced dealing with asbestos cases.

Based on the state you reside in depending on your state, you may need to satisfy certain requirements to file an asbestos death claim. In New York State, for instance, a mesothelioma death lawsuit must be filed within three years from the date the victim was or ought to be aware of their exposure to asbestos.

Inhalation of asbestos fibers is the most popular method by which people are exposed to this toxic substance. When asbestos fibers enter the body, they are in the organ tissue linings, such as the lungs and heart. The fibers can also become stuck in the abdominal lining and testicles. These fibers can cause serious problems in the future, including mesothelioma that is malignant.

Mesothelioma is a rare, cancerous condition that affects the lung linings or chest wall, as well as the abdomen is a rare form of cancer. In most cases, the mesothelioma cancer isn't discovered until it has spread. Mesothelioma is usually life-threatening and can be very difficult to treat.

Mesothelioma isn't curable unlike other cancers. However, a treatment program can reduce the symptoms and improve patients' quality of life. In certain instances, mesothelioma may be prevented through preventive measures.
